This series consists of registers that document enlistments in the united states army from 1798 to 1914. The registers generally contain information relating to the enlistment and termination of service of enlisted personnel.

The government passed the national registration act on 15 july 1915 as a step towards stimulating recruitment and to discover how many men between the ages of 15 and 65 were engaged in each trade. All those in this age range who were not already in the military were obliged to register, giving details of their employment details.

After a relatively slow start, there was a sudden surge in recruiting in late august and early september 1914. In all, 478,893 men joined the army between 4 august and 12 september, including 33,204 on 3 september alone – the highest daily total of the war and more than the average annual intake in the years immediately before 1914.

A peacetime order of battle of the united states army for august of 1914 (the outbreak of the world war in europe), listing the divisions, brigades, regiments, and battalions of infantry, cavalry, field artillery, coast artillery, and engineers with their permanent garrisons and actual locations, all down to the company, troop, and battery level.

The 1916 somme offensive was one of the largest and bloodiest battles of the first world war (1914-18). The opening day of the attack, 1 july 1916, saw the british army sustain 57,000 casualties, the bloodiest day in its history. The campaign finally ended in mid-november after an agonising five-month struggle that failed to secure a breakthrough.
